1. A method for performing channel sounding in a wireless LAN system, the method comprising the steps of:

  • transmitting a null data packet announcement (NDPA) frame to announce a transmission of a null data packet (NDP);

    transmitting the NDP; and

    receiving a feedback frame from a station (STA),wherein the feedback frame includes channel state information generated based on the NDP,wherein the NDP includes a signal field, a first long training field (LTF) used in channel estimation for decoding the signal field and a second LTF used in channel estimation for a multiple input multiple output (MIMO) channel,wherein the signal field includes a repetition indication subfield,wherein the repetition indication subfield indicates whether or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(OFDM) symbol repetition is applied to the second LTF,wherein the first LTF is transmitted as an OFDM symbol for the first LTF and as a repetition OFDM symbol in which the first LTF is repeated regardless of the repetition indication subfield, andwherein when the repetition indication subfield indicates that the OFDM symbol repetition is not applied to the second LTF, the second LTF is transmitted as a first long training symbol (LTS) for each LTF.
